Major Fire Breaks Out at Unnao District Noodles Factory

A significant fire erupted at a noodles manufacturing plant located outside Oonchadwar village in Unnao district on Monday morning. The factory, which belongs to a resident of Lucknow, became engulfed in flames during the early hours.

Short Circuit Suspected as Cause

Authorities suspect a short circuit triggered the devastating blaze. The incident began around 3 am on Sunday night when fiery balls started emerging from inside the factory building.

The Agro factory operates in the Kotwali area just outside Oonchadwar village. Workers reported seeing intense flames spreading rapidly through the facility.

Four-Hour Firefighting Battle

Two fire tenders arrived at the scene approximately thirty minutes after receiving the emergency call. Firefighters worked tirelessly for four continuous hours before finally bringing the raging fire under control.

Kotwal Sharad Kumar confirmed that the firefighting teams successfully contained the blaze. One fire vehicle remains stationed at the location as a precautionary measure to extinguish any potential flare-ups.

Extensive Material Damage Reported

The fire caused substantial destruction to factory materials stored inside the facility. Mustard oil, pasta products, macaroni, porridge supplies, flour, gram flour, and soya chunks all suffered damage in the intense blaze.

Local police have launched a thorough investigation into the incident. Officers are currently examining the factory premises to determine the exact sequence of events that led to the fire.

The factory's remote location outside Oonchadwar village presented additional challenges for emergency responders. Despite these difficulties, fire crews managed to prevent the flames from spreading to nearby structures.
